Copper gutter replacement services involve removing old or damaged gutters and installing new copper gutters to ensure proper water management around a property. This process typically includes assessing the existing gutter system, measuring for the correct fit, and securely attaching the new copper components to the roofline. Copper gutters are valued for their durability, aesthetic appeal, and resistance to corrosion, making them a popular choice for homeowners seeking a long-lasting solution for their drainage needs.

This service helps address common problems such as leaks, rust, sagging, or overflowing gutters that can lead to water damage, foundation issues, or landscape erosion. Over time, gutters can become clogged or deteriorate, especially in areas with heavy rainfall or harsh weather conditions. Replacing old gutters with copper options can prevent water from spilling over the sides, protect the home's exterior, and reduce the risk of costly repairs caused by improper drainage.

The overview below groups typical Copper Gutter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- minor gutter fixes or sealant applications typically cost between $150 and $400. Many routine repairs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the work needed. Fewer projects reach higher prices unless additional issues are present.

Partial Replacement - replacing sections of gutters usually ranges from $600 to $1,200 for most homes. Local contractors often handle these projects within this band, though larger or more complex jobs can cost more.

Full Gutter Replacement - complete replacement of gutters generally costs between $1,500 and $3,500. Many homeowners find their projects fall into this middle range, with larger or custom installations reaching higher prices.

Complex or Large-Scale Projects - extensive gutter systems or custom features can cost $4,000 or more. These higher-tier projects are less common and typically involve additional materials or specialized installation requ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of choosing copper gutters? Copper gutters are known for their durability, natural corrosion resistance, and attractive appearance that can enhance a property's curb appeal.

How do copper gutters compare to other gutter materials? Copper gutters typically last longer and require less maintenance than aluminum or vinyl options, offering a more permanent solution.

What signs indicate that copper gutters need replacement? Visible corrosion, leaks, sagging, or significant dents can suggest that copper gutters may need to be replaced by a professional.
